Understanding University Wi-Fi Networks

University Wi-Fi networks can be complex and different from traditional home networks. Understanding how these networks operate is crucial for ensuring smooth connectivity for your TV streaming needs. University Wi-Fi networks are designed to accommodate a large number of users simultaneously, which can sometimes lead to bandwidth limitations during peak usage hours. Additionally, these networks often have stricter security protocols in place to protect sensitive academic and personal information.

To navigate these challenges, it’s important to familiarize yourself with the university’s Wi-Fi policies and guidelines. Knowing the specific login credentials required, network restrictions, and any additional security measures can help you troubleshoot connectivity issues more effectively. Many universities also offer IT support services for students, so don’t hesitate to reach out for assistance if needed.

Setting Up Your Tv For Connection

Setting up your TV for connection to university Wi-Fi is a straightforward process that requires a few simple steps. Begin by ensuring that your TV is equipped with Wi-Fi capabilities. Most modern smart TVs come with built-in Wi-Fi connectivity, allowing you to easily connect to wireless networks.

Next, locate the Wi-Fi settings on your TV. This is typically found in the settings or network menu. Select the option to connect to a new wireless network and choose the university Wi-Fi network from the list of available connections. You may be prompted to enter the network password, so have this information handy.

Once you have entered the correct network credentials, your TV should successfully connect to the university Wi-Fi network. Test the connection by streaming a video or accessing online content to ensure that everything is working smoothly. If you encounter any issues, double-check the network settings and ensure that you have entered the correct password.

Selecting The Right Wireless Adapter

When it comes to connecting your TV to university Wi-Fi, selecting the right wireless adapter is crucial for ensuring a seamless streaming experience. Wireless adapters come in various types and specifications, so it’s essential to choose one that is compatible with your TV and the university network. Look for a dual-band wireless adapter to ensure compatibility with both 2.4GHz and 5GHz frequencies commonly used in Wi-Fi networks.

Consider the speed and range of the wireless adapter to ensure smooth streaming without interruptions or buffering. Higher speeds and longer ranges are particularly important if you plan on streaming high-definition content or gaming. Additionally, opt for a wireless adapter with easy setup features like plug-and-play functionality or simple installation steps to avoid any technical challenges during the setup process. Connecting Via Ethernet Cable

Connecting to university Wi-Fi via an Ethernet cable offers a reliable and fast connection for seamless streaming on your TV. To get started, locate the Ethernet port on your TV and plug one end of the cable into the port. Then, connect the other end of the cable to an available Ethernet port on the university network wall socket.

Using an Ethernet cable ensures a more stable connection compared to relying solely on wireless networks. This is particularly beneficial for streaming high-definition content without buffering or lag issues. Additionally, Ethernet connections provide better security and are less susceptible to interference, ensuring a more consistent streaming experience.

Troubleshooting Common Connection Issues

When it comes to connecting your TV to university Wi-Fi, encountering common connection issues can be frustrating. One of the most common problems is a weak or unstable signal, which can cause buffering or poor video quality. To troubleshoot this issue, ensure your TV is close to the Wi-Fi router for a stronger connection.

Another common problem is entering the wrong Wi-Fi password or network information. Double-check that you have entered the correct details to avoid connectivity issues. Additionally, check if there are any software updates available for your TV, as outdated software can also cause connection problems.

If you are still experiencing issues, try restarting both your TV and the Wi-Fi router to reset the connection. You can also reach out to your university’s IT department for further assistance and guidance on resolving any persistent connection issues.

Optimizing Streaming Quality

To optimize your streaming quality on your TV connected to university Wi-Fi, consider a few key factors. Firstly, ensure you have a stable internet connection by positioning your router close to your TV and eliminating any potential interference. This will help minimize buffering and loading times, providing a smoother streaming experience.

Secondly, adjust the video quality settings on your streaming apps to match the internet speed available on your university network. Lowering the resolution can help prevent lags and buffering issues, especially during peak usage times when the network may be congested.

Lastly, consider using an Ethernet cable to directly connect your TV to the university network if possible. This can provide a more reliable and faster connection compared to Wi-Fi, ultimately improving the overall streaming quality on your TV. What Steps Can I Take If My Tv Is Not Connecting To The Wi-Fi?

First, try restarting both your TV and Wi-Fi router. Check if other devices can connect to the Wi-Fi network to determine if the issue lies with the TV. If the problem persists, ensure the TV is within range of the Wi-Fi signal and that there are no obstructions. Resetting the network settings on the TV or updating its firmware may also help resolve the connectivity issue. If all else fails, contact the manufacturer’s customer support for further assistance.

Is It Important To Have The University Wi-Fi Login Credentials Before Attempting To Connect The Tv?

Yes, it is important to have the university Wi-Fi login credentials before attempting to connect the TV. University Wi-Fi networks typically require authentication through a username and password, and without these credentials, the TV will not be able to join the network. Having the correct login credentials is essential for establishing a secure and reliable connection to the university Wi-Fi, ensuring that the TV can access online content and services without any issues.
